[quote=Anonymous]I am on my second job. Previous family schedule: Arrive 20 minutes before having to walk to bus stop Empty dishwasher Load breakfast dishes Do a step of laundry (so Monday I'd carry down all the clothes to wash--and move them to dryer after snack--Tuesday I'd bring up clean laundry to fold while kids did HW, Wednesday I'd take clothes to kids' rooms and lay it out for them to put away, Thursday wash/dry another load, Friday fold, they put away on the weekend). Walk to bus and get kids. Have them put stuff away, wash hands, eat snack Sit with them while they do homework Remind them to do piano They have 1 hour free play while I do very basic dinner prep (put a casserole in the oven, make rice, etc.) Current job: Pick kids up at school Drive them home Have them put their stuff away Shower They do their own laundry, so I just supervise/ remind them when it needs to be done (kids are 6 and 7, btw!) They had a snack at school and don't have homework, but do need me to sit with them while they do instruments. They have about two hours of free play time, during which I typically make dinner from scratch. He exception is one night a week when we have a very long activity instead of free play time, so we always eat leftovers or get takeout from chipotle or something. [/quote]
